Q. The debut film of Sharmila Tagore was with which director?
Answer:
Satyajit Ray
Notes: Born into the prominent Tagore family, one of the leading families of Calcutta and a key influence during the Bengali Renaissance, Sharmila Tagore made her acting debut at age 14 with Satyajit Ray's acclaimed Bengali drama The World of Apu (1959). She went on to collaborate with Ray on numerous other films, including; Devi (1960), Nayak (1966), Aranyer Din Ratri (1970), and Seemabaddha (1971); thus, establishing herself as one of the most prominent figures in Bengali cinema.
